#1fce69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fce69 is composed of 12.2% red, 80.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85% cyan, 0% magenta, 49%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 145.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 46.5%. #1fce69 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effd2 with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1fce69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fce69 has RGB values of R:31, G:206,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 2084457.

Shades and Tints of #1fce69
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fce69
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717c76 is the less saturated color, while #04e965 is the most saturated one.
